61211696 | about 7 years ago | So this was mapped really carefully previously -- did you survey this on foot? There are no-entry signs at either end -- there is no other signage. So, that doesn't stop cyclists entering in the middle of the road from the footpath and exiting (potentially from either end) -- many regularly exit onto the A38. To a certain extent "access=no" also messes up the routing for pedestrians too. Maybe you could reconsider your changes. |

60227126 | about 7 years ago | Great to see some new houses being added -- even better to get housenumbers. If it's possible (and I know it's not always clear) could you add the street too -- makes it lot more useful for navigating. E.g. OsmAnd shows all housenumbers it "knows" when you pick a street, so it can route you to the door :-) |
